Implementation of ate pairing on arm

Witryna18 maj 2011 · Pairings on elliptic curves are being used in an increasing number of cryptographic applications on many different devices and platforms, but few … WitrynaIn our implementation, this favors using affine coordinates, even for the current 128-bit minimum security level specified by NIST. We use Barreto-Naehrig (BN) curves and report on the performance of an optimal ate pairing for curves covering security levels between 128 and 192 bits.

Efficient Implementation of Bilinear Pairings on ARM Processors

Witryna6 maj 2024 · The precompiled contract can be implemented using elliptic curve pairing functions, more specifically, an optimal ate pairing on the alt_bn128 curve, which can be implemented efficiently. In order to see that, first note that a pairing function e: G_1 x G_2 -> G_T fulfills the following properties ( G_1 and G_2 are written additively, G_T … Witryna1 sty 2011 · PDF We report on relative performance numbers for affine and projective pairings on a dual-core Cortex A9 ARM processor. Using a fast inversion in the... … the peninsula shop w2 w4 https://internetmarketingandcreative.com

Affine pairings on ARM Proceedings of the 5th international ...

Witryna1 sty 2010 · The R-ate pairing is one of the fastest pairings over large prime fields. In this study, we implemented the R-ate pairing at the security level equivalent to 128-bit AES key on BREW... Witrynarecently, Aranha et al. [3] have computed the O-Ate pairing at the 128-bit secu-rity level in under 2 million cycles on various 64-bit PC processors. In contrast, relativelyfew … WitrynaOpen ate/ate.sln and compile test_bn with Release mode. The produced binary is ate/x64/Release/test_bn.exe. Cygwin Install mingw64-x86_64-gcc-g++ (run Cygwin setup and search mingw64 ). Then use the following commands: PATH=/usr/x86_64-w64-mingw32/sys-root/mingw/bin/:$PATH make -j test/bn.exe the peninsula serviced apartments

Accelerating Beta Weil Pairing with Precomputation and Multi-pairing …

Category:Software Implementation of Pairing Based Cryptography on FPGA

Tags:Implementation of ate pairing on arm

Implementation of ate pairing on arm

Ukraine denies its troops are surrounded in Bakhmut

Witrynaas the Tate pairing [1], R-ate pairing [2], ate pairing [3] and optimal pairings [4], choose and to be specific cyclic subgroups of ( ... implementation of pairings over BN curves was proposed. In 2010 Fan et al. [6] proposed a new pipelined and parallelized version of their HMM [8]. In 2011, Corona et al. [9] proposed a new hardware ... Witryna14 cze 2012 · In this paper, we investigate the efficient computation of the Optimal-Ate pairing over Barreto-Naehrig curves in software at different security levels on ARM …

Implementation of ate pairing on arm

Did you know?

Witrynaand Optimal Ate pairings in Jacobean coordinates, over Barreto-Naehrig curve, on Virtex-5 using the MicroBlaze software processor and the ZedBoard Zynq- 7000 platform using ARM hardcore processor. Witrynaالفرق التقني الأساسي بين معالجات Intel ومعالجات ARM هو أنّ الأولى تستخدم معماريّة شهيرة تدعى x86 وتعتمد على مجموعة تعليمات معقّدة تدعى CISC، في حين تستخدم ARM معماريّتها الخاصّة التي تعتمد على مجموعة تعليمات مبسّطة تدعى …

WitrynaThe proposed optimal Ate pairing architecture at 128 bits security level has been implemented on Xilinx FPGA Virtex6. Our processor implemented over BN curves achieves the highest reported... Witryna18 maj 2011 · We use Barreto-Naehrig (BN) curves and report on the performance of an optimal ate pairing for curves covering security levels roughly between 128 and 192 bits. We compare with other reported performance …

WitrynaThe comparison of our software implementation with related implementa- tions of Ate pairings over BN curves providing approximately 128-bit security is summarized in … Witryna26 mar 2024 · This paper presents the software implementation of Weil, Tate, Ate and Optimal Ate pairings in Jacobean coordinates, over Barreto-Naehrig curve, on Virtex-5 using the MicroBlaze software...

Witrynaa k=10, D=1 Brezing–Weng curve in R. Matsumura, Y. Takahashi, Y. Nanjo, T. Kusaka and Y. Nogami, Implementation and Evaluation of Ate Pairings on Elliptic Curves with Embedding Degree 10 Applied Type-II All-One Polynomial Extension Field of Degree 5, ITC-CSCC, Nagoya, Japan, July 3-6, 2024, pp. 336–341, online paper 1.

WitrynaThe ARMv7 architecture is a 32-bit processor architecture. It is also a load/store architecture, meaning that data-processing instructions operate only on values in … siamsa horseWitrynaImplementing Cryptographic Pairings on ARM dual-core Processors. Abstract:In this paper, we explore the parallelization capabilities of the ARM processing system … the peninsulas mount pleasant txWitryna13 gru 2024 · In this research, we present a fast and energy efficient implementation of PBC based on Barreto-Naehrig (BN) curves and optimal Ate pairing using hardware/software co-design. Our solution consists of a hardware-based Montgomery multiplier, and pairing software running on an ARM Cortex A9 processor in a Zynq … siamsa in englishWitryna14 sie 2024 · ing from the Weil pairing to the Optimale Ate pairing. We also discuss Miller’s algorithm, which makes the computation of bilinear pairings feasible, and other ... III.Implementation of Pairings 70 7. Techniques to Speed up Pairing Computations 71 7.1. Towered Extension Fields and Finite Field Arithmetic . . . . . . . . .71 siamsa east stroudsburgWitryna1 wrz 2024 · The design of a fast software library for the computation of the optimal ate pairing on a Barreto-Naehrig elliptic curve is described, able to compute the optimal eating pairing over a 254-bit prime field Fp, in just 2.33 million of clock cycles. 196 PDF FPGA Implementation of Pairings Using Residue Number System and Lazy Reduction the peninsula santa monicaWitryna1 lut 2024 · It was found that on ARM v7 Cortex-A9 processors the computation of the optimal Ate pairing based on NEON does not perform better than an optimized ARM … the peninsula sidney bcWitrynaIt is the purpose of this paper to bridge the gap between theory and practice, and to show that even complex protocols may have a surprisingly efficient implementation. We also point out that in some cases the usually recommended … the peninsula sports club